Top commentator tips

In the world of blogging, interactivity and commenting adds value to an online community. If you are a blogger I am sure you’ll realise that commenting on other blogs can increase traffic and gain new readers to your blog.

When I comment on other blogs my traffic does increase. However, commenting is something that I need to do on a daily basis in order to gain new visits. As you read a blog, you’ll notice that other readers will leave comments, some like: “great post”, those aren’t really clickable comments.

The best comments are ones that add some value to the post and make the conversation flowing. Other bloggers will are more likely to click on a comment with some valuable additional input to the current post.

5 tips to become a top commentator

  1. Subscribe to comments – Add a useful comment to a blog post, then subscribe to the comments. The key here is to keep the conversation flowing between the other commentators. The more in depth comments you can add to the blog, the more likely you’ll keep the conversation flowing.
  2. Comment on other posts – Read other posts throughout the blog and apply some useful comments to the post.
  3. Guest post – A great way to give comments is write a guest post for another blogger. Subscribe to the guest post and answer all the comments on the blog post you’ve written. In the long term, you are helping some many people. Firstly, you’re helping the blogger that you’ve written the guest post for. Secondly, you’re commenting on the blog and you’re adding even more value to their blog.  Guest posting is about building relationships with other bloggers and reaching a new audience.
  4. Write useful comments – Make sure you contribute to a blog post by leaving useful, resourceful comments. Remember that a blog reader will click on good comments, because they maybe curious to hear more of your knowledge and expertise.
  5. Use keyword rich anchor text - For your title use a keyword rich name. I am trying to rank high in Google for SEO tips, so I’ll use SEO tips as a title name. When you comment on do-follow blogs you are doing link building as well. Make the most of your blog commenting. Make sure you vary your keywords when link building, because Google doesn’t like spam comments.
  6. Bonus tip – Link to other pages in your blog - When creating comments apply use different hyperlinks into your blog. Many people would just link to the home page. Add different URLs into the website box. This is a simple way of creating deep links into your blog.
